How Can Finding an Albany French Tutor Near Me Help Me Work Towards Fluency?
French is a beautiful language that is widely spoken around the world. It is one of the six official United Nations languages, and it is one of the five Latin languages that are spoken today along with Spanish, Italian, Portuguese, and Romanian. It can also be difficult to learn for non-native speakers. Elements of the language such as gendered nouns and the use of five different kinds of accent marks that can affect the pronunciation of a word have been known to trip up students and professionals, and many find that they do need some additional help in their studies.
